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
577449762 448173 56653423
85196220282 485572
85196220282 485572
1562 5028 322 87644
All about undefined
Interested in learning more?
85196220282 485572
1562 5028 322 87644
See more
6455045 75126658774 7372152232
65155 52894287 7375101
See more
64783223 31573
4936199423 344487 59992953378
See more